§ 2752. Smoking
(a) A person who smokes a pipe, cigar or cigarette in a mill, factory, barn, stable or other outbuilding belonging to or occupied by another person, or in a public building in which a notice containing this section, prohibiting such smoking, signed by the owner, agent, occupant or custodian of the same is posted conspicuously near the main entrance thereof, shall be fined not more than $5.00.
(b) All prosecutions under this section shall be commenced within thirty days from the date of the offense.
